Versonnex mountain bike trails are set at the foot of the Jura Mountains, offering diverse landscapes for riders. The region features a mix of valleys, open fields, and dense forests, transitioning to higher plateaus. Riders can experience varied terrain, from smooth paths to technical sections, with views of the Jura, Geneva, and Mont Blanc from various points. Mont Mourex is a prominent local feature, providing trails with scenic vistas and varying levels of difficulty.

  • The most popular mountain bike trail is Cécile's Grand Tour – Relais de Crempigny Fountain loop from Lornay, a moderate 20.4 miles (32.8 km) trail that takes 3 hours 4 minutes to complete, traversing varied landscapes with significant elevation changes.
  • Another top favourite among local mountain bikers is Mountainbike loop from Versonnex, a moderate 12.1 miles (19.5 km) path. This route offers a mix of forest tracks and open sections, providing a balanced riding experience directly from Versonnex.
  • Local mountain bikers also love the Mountainbike loop from Vallières, an easy 7.2 miles (11.6 km) trail leading through rural landscapes and woodlands, often completed in about 53 minutes.
  • Mountain biking around Versonnex is defined by its proximity to the Jura Mountains, diverse forest tracks, and open plateau sections. The network offers options for different ability levels, from leisurely rides to more challenging ascents.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are there around Versonnex?

Versonnex offers a wide selection of mountain bike trails, with nearly 160 routes available. These range from easy rides to more challenging ascents, catering to various skill levels.

What are the difficulty levels of mountain bike trails near Versonnex?

The trails around Versonnex cater to all skill levels. You'll find 27 easy routes, 90 moderate routes, and 42 difficult routes. This variety ensures that both beginners and experienced riders can find suitable challenges.

Are there any family-friendly mountain bike trails in Versonnex?

Yes, there are several family-friendly options. For an easier ride, consider the Mountainbike loop from Vallières, an easy 11.6 km trail through rural landscapes and woodlands, often completed in under an hour. The region's diverse terrain includes smoother paths suitable for less experienced riders.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ails in Versonnex?

The terrain around Versonnex is highly varied, transitioning from valleys and open fields to dense forests and higher plateaus at the foot of the Jura Mountains. You can expect a mix of smooth paths, forest tracks, singletracks, and more technical sections with significant elevation changes, offering a dynamic riding experience.

Are there mountain bike trails that offer scenic views?

Absolutely. Many trails provide stunning vistas of the Jura Mountains, Geneva, and even Mont Blanc. Mont Mourex is a prominent local feature with trails offering scenic views. The region's diverse landscape ensures picturesque surroundings throughout your ride.

Are there any circular mountain bike routes available from Versonnex?

Yes, many routes are designed as loops. For example, the Mountainbike loop from Versonnex is a moderate 19.5 km path offering a balanced riding experience directly from the town. Another option is the Clermont-en-Genevois – Cécile's Grand Tour loop from Versonnex, a moderate 19.9 km route.

What are some notable natural features or attractions to see along the mountain bike trails?

While riding, you might encounter various natural features and attractions. The region is known for its proximity to the Jura Mountains. You can also explore highlights such as the Old bridge of Seyssel or the dramatic Fier Gorge. For those interested in mountain passes, the Col du Clergeon is also nearby.

Are there specific trails for electric mountain bikes (VTTAE) near Versonnex?

Yes, the wider Ain department, where Versonnex is located, has a strong focus on mountain biking, including 29 specific trails dedicated to electric mountain bikes (VTTAE). This makes mountain biking accessible to those seeking assisted rides across the diverse terrain.

What is the best time of year for mountain biking in Versonnex?

The diverse landscape around Versonnex, with its mix of valleys, forests, and plateaus, offers good riding conditions through much of the year. While specific seasonal conditions can vary, spring and autumn generally provide pleasant temperatures and vibrant scenery. Summer is also popular, but be mindful of potential heat on exposed sections.
